Essential Game Assets: Building a Pixel Art World
Creating a captivating pixel art world relies on multiple key game resources . Think beyond simply sprites; the complete feel demands meticulous planning. Here's the quick look:
- Tilesets: These are your foundation. Build different tile variations for ground , barriers , and decorations .
- Character Sprites: Your player protagonist needs some selection of animations – standing , walking , striking, and perishing.
- Enemy Sprites: Don't forget concerning your ! Every creature needs the unique look and behaviors.
- Props & Items: Include engaging things like containers, plants , and boosts .
- UI Elements: The clean and usable user system is necessary. Think buttons , screens , and health bars .
Ultimately , crafting a pixel art realm is your process of care . Prioritize quality and explore with unique styles to create something truly impressive.

Designing Reusable Pixel Art Tilesets for Game Development
Crafting effective retro art tilesets for video game development copyrights on forethought for modular layout. Instead of building assets individually , pixel art focus on tiny units that can be readily combined to form a variety of landscapes . Consider using a framework for consistency , ensuring seamless transitions between neighboring tiles. Using a simple color palette also promotes adaptability and lessens visual clutter . Ultimately, thoughtfully made tilesets save resources and boost the general level of your creation.
- Employ symmetrical tile arrangements.
- Establish clear tile limits.
- Test tile connection in various placements.
